Bridge Drama take to the stage with ‘Memoirs’ play

- By ANNA HAYES

BRIDGE DRAMA will begin their All Ireland Drama Circuit campaign at the Jerome Hynes Theatre this weekend when they stage their first performanc­es of ‘Brighton Beach Memoirs’ by Neil Simon.

Two time All Ireland winning director Pat Whelan is back at the helm and revisiting the work of the playwright that, three years ago, won them a coveted Best Play Award for ‘Lost In Yonkers’.

Three of the cast from that production return this year: Sean Byrne plays Eugene; Cillian Tobin plays the role of Stanley, while his father and group stalwart Paul Tobin takes on the role of Jack.

Mairead Cummings plays Blanche with Louise Wickham Dillon taking the role of Kate, Ailbhe Tierney playing Laurie, and Katie Connick in the role of Nora.

Set in Brooklyn, New York in 1937, the play focuses on Eugene Jerome and his family as they fight the hard times and sometimes each other, with laughter, tears and love. Eugene guides the audience through his ‘memoirs’, with a series of trenchant observatio­ns and insights that show his family meeting life’s challenges with pride, spirit and a marvellous sense of humour.

But as World War II looms ever closer, Eugene sees his own innocence slipping away as the first important era of his life ends, and a new one begins.

In true Simon fashion, ‘Brighton Beach Memoirs’ is a heart-warming family comedy drama delivering laughs but following them up with beautifull­y touching moments.

The group is also celebratin­g 20 years since their first performanc­e in 1999. Their first circuit production, in 2002, was also a Simon play, ‘Rumours’.
